Former Bears Thayer, Hilgenberg Sign Autographs Saturday

June 22, 2010 - Arena Football League (AFL)
Chicago Rush News Release


Former Chicago Bears linemen Tom Thayer and Jay Hilgenberg will sign autographs Saturday night at the Chicago Rush game against the Orlando Predators, the Rush announced today.

Thayer and Hilgenberg will be stationed at the Gridiron Greats Assistant Fund booth in the Allstate Arena concourse beginning at 6 p.m. when the arena doors open. They will sign autographs from 6 p.m. to 7 p.m. Fans will have the option of getting either an autograph or a photo taken with Thayer and Hilgenberg - limited to one per fan - by making a $5 donation to the GGAF.

The Gridiron Greats Assistance Fund (GGAF) is a non-profit, 501(c) (3) corporation, established to provide financial assistance and coordinate social services to dire need retired NFL players who are pioneers of the game and have greatly contributed to the NFL's status as the most popular sport in America.

Thanks to Mike Ditka's involvement as owner of the Rush and member of the GGAF's Board of Directors, Gridiron Greats has a presence at each Rush home game, staffing a booth in the concourse with GGAF merchandise for sale to benefit the charity. In addition, GGAF has had former NFL stars such as Dan Hampton, Keith Van Horne, Emery Moorhead, Robbie Gould and Kurt Becker make appearances to sign autographs throughout the season.
